Research the Company's Licensing and Certification

When looking for an HVAC contractor, it's key to check their licensing and certification. In Florida, HVAC contractors need a license from the Florida Department of Business and Professional Regulations (DBPR). This shows they know how to do HVAC work safely and well.

Checking these credentials helps protect your money and makes sure they follow state rules.

Verify that the license is in compliance with Florida State Regulations

To make sure you get a skilled HVAC technician, verify HVAC license status on the Florida DBPR website. There are two main licenses: Certified contractors can work anywhere in Florida, while Registered contractors can only work in their area. Class A contractors are the most experienced, while Class B contractors specialize in smaller systems.

These facts are important to know when choosing a contractor.

Insurance Coverage: A Crucial Factor

Insurance Coverage plays a major role in choosing an HVAC contractor. Look for proof of general liability and worker's compensation insurance. General liability covers your property against damage caused by workers. Worker's compensation keeps you safe if an employee gets hurt on your property.

What to Include in Your Estimate

To fully understand an HVAC project, your estimates should cover several areas:

  • Labor Costs: Details on installation labor for simple, moderate, or complex setups.
  • Costs of Equipment: Details on HVAC systems and their costs per sq. foot.
  • Permits and Additional Fees: Breakdown of permits, system designs, and other supplies.
  • Warranty and Maintenance: Details about installation and equipment warranties as well as maintenance tips.
  • Energy Efficiency Rates: Rates to choose energy-efficient HVAC systems.
